Frequently asked questions

What does „Hilfskraft“ mean in English?
„Hilfskraft“ means „assistant“ or „helper“ in English, depending on the context.
Is „Hilfskraft“ the same as „Aushilfe“?
Not exactly. „Aushilfe“ usually means a temporary helper or casual worker, while „Hilfskraft“ is a more general term for a support worker or assistant.
Is „Hilfskraft“ masculine or feminine?
Grammatically, „die Hilfskraft“ is feminine in German, even when it refers to a man.
